Job Duties
Serves as a primary data entry operator for the Admissions Office. Accurately enter data from numerous types of source documents including the undergraduate and non-matriculation applications. Provide professional customer service to all students, prospective students, parents, faculty, staff and the general public via telephone, e-mail, fax, walk-ins and counter assistance.
Minimum Qualifications
Possess experience in the performance of various office services support duties. Demonstrated knowledge of effective customer service. Demonstrated ability to prioritize work and make workflow decisions independently. Experienced in a clerical administrative setting.

In support of the Commonwealth's commitment to inclusion, we are encouraging individuals with disabilities to apply through the Commonwealth Alternative Hiring Process. To be considered for this opportunity, applicants will need to provide their AHP Letter (formerly COD) provided by the Department for Aging & Rehabilitative Services (DARS), or the Department for the Blind & Vision Impaired (DBVI). Service-Connected Veterans are encouraged to answer Veteran status questions and submit their disability documentation, if applicable, to DARS/DBVI to get their AHP Letter. Requesting an AHP Letter can be found at AHP Letter or by calling DARS at 800-552-5019.
Note :
Applicants who received a Certificate of Disability from DARS or DBVI dated between April 1, 2022- February 29, 2024, can still use that COD as applicable documentation for the Alternative Hiring Process.
